Analyzing Historical Returns

Data from reputable sources like Coingecko and CryptoRank indicate that LaunchPad projects on major exchanges have consistently delivered high returns, with average peak multiples exceeding 10x. Among these, Bitget stands out with an average historical peak return of 39x for its LaunchPad projects. Bybit and Binance follow closely, with average returns of 32.3x and 29x respectively. Notably, Bitget's TYPE token achieved a staggering 68x return, marking it as one of the highest-performing launches in 2023.

The performance of exchange tokens themselves also plays a crucial role in overall returns. Since participation in LaunchPads typically requires holding the platform's native token, significant price fluctuations can impact net profitability. While most platform tokens have seen positive price movement this year, few have outperformed Bitcoin's 107% growth. Bitget's BGB token is a notable exception, surging 168% since January, thereby offering participants additional gains on top of LaunchPad returns.

Frequency of New Launches

The number of new projects launched is another indicator of a LaunchPad's vitality. In 2023, Bitget has been particularly active, launching five projects through its LaunchPad, including the recent T2T2 project—an enhanced version of Friend.tech with expanded functionality. Binance ranks second with three launches, while OKX and Bybit have taken a more conservative approach with one project each this year.

Beyond quantity, Bitget has demonstrated an ability to identify and list promising tokens early, often beating competitors to market. Evolution of Participation Models

The standard LaunchPad model, pioneered by Binance, involves holding platform tokens to qualify for lottery-based participation. While this approach remains prevalent, its appeal has diminished over time. In response, Bitget has introduced innovative variations, such as a group-buying mechanism that lowers entry barriers (starting at 50 BGB) and incorporates social elements. This new model has already attracted thousands of teams and tens of thousands of participants, indicating strong user engagement.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a cryptocurrency LaunchPad?
A LaunchPad is a platform provided by exchanges to facilitate the initial sale and distribution of new tokens. It allows users to invest in early-stage projects before they become widely available on the open market.

How do I participate in a LaunchPad?
Participation typically requires holding the exchange's native token. Users then commit these tokens to a lottery or subscription process, with winners receiving allocation rights to purchase the new token at a predetermined price.

What risks are associated with LaunchPad investments?
While LaunchPads can offer high returns, they also carry risks such as token price volatility, project failure, and market downturns. It's essential to research each project thoroughly and consider the stability of the platform token used for participation.

Can LaunchPad participation be profitable in a bear market?
Yes, though returns may be moderated. Historical data shows that well-vetted projects can still achieve significant multiples even during market corrections, making LaunchPads a viable option throughout market cycles.

How do I choose the best LaunchPad?
Evaluate platforms based on their historical performance, token launch frequency, and participation models. Also, consider the strength of the exchange's token, as its performance can directly impact your net returns.

Are there alternatives to lottery-based LaunchPads?
Yes, some platforms are experimenting with new models like group buying or tiered systems based on token holdings. These alternatives can offer more predictable access and lower entry barriers.
